INTRODUCTION William D. Gann (1878 to 1955) was an outstanding stock and commodities trader. He was also a prolific teacher of how to make speculation a profitable profession, writing some seven books and producing two courses on trading the stock and commodity markets. However, Ganns superlative skill was his ability to produce annual forecasts of the stock and commodity markets one year in advance. Although he also sent his clients supplements, which corrected his annual forecasts when necessary, the overall accuracy of these annual forecasts is highly impressive. For example, Ganns annual stockmarket forecast for 1929, which was published in November 1928, unequivocally forecast the Great Crash in the fall of 1929. However, Gann continued to produce and publish annual forecasts of the stock and commodity markets until shortly before his death in 1955.

THE TIME FACTOR IS THE KEY TO GANNS FORECASTS Ganns forecasts of the stock and commodity markets were based on the time factor, the dictionary definition of which is The passage of time as a limitation on what can be achieved. Gann provided the following comments on the time factor: The most important thing of all is the Time factor, which I use in making up my annual forecasts. It is not my object here to give away that secret, but I am showing you plain enough and giving you rules enough that, if you follow them, you will be able to make a success in the stock market (Truth Of The Stock Tape, 1923, page 116). Many people want to know what method I use to determine future indications on the market. I keep charts of the various active stocks and also a set of averages. My charts are different from the charts of the average statistician because they are based on a discovery of my own. I have discovered a time factor that enables me to determine important tops and bottoms one year or more in advance. My annual forecasts on stocks, issued in December for ten years past, have proved remarkably correct. The cotton and grain markets can also be forecast by this time factor, which enables me to tell when extreme highs and lows will be made, as well as the minor moves (Truth Of The Stock Tape, 1923, page 41 of appendix). The time factor and time periods are most important in determining a change in trend because time can over balance price, and when the time is up the volume of sales will increase and force prices higher or lower (45 Years In Wall Street, 1941, page 10). Time is the most important factor of all and not until sufficient time has expired does any big move start up or down. The time factor will overbalance both space and volume. When time is up, space movement will start and large volume will begin, either up or down. At the end of any important movement monthly, weekly or daily Time must be allowed for accumulation or

distribution or for buying and selling to be completed (How To Make Profits In Commodities, 1951, page 56). Therefore we learn from Gann that: 1) The time factor is the most important element in forecasting markets; and therefore he used this time factor in producing his highly-accurate annual forecasts of the stock and commodity markets. 2) The time factor is so fundamental that it precedes (and therefore causes) changes in prices and changes in volume in the stock and commodity markets. 3) The time factor is a valuable secret, details of which he is unwilling to reveal. He is however prepared to teach trading rules which, when properly applied, produce profits in the stock and commodity markets.

GANNS NOVEL ENTITLED THE TUNNEL THRU THE AIR Although Gann was unwilling to explicitly reveal his time factor in his books and courses on trading the stock and commodity markets, he was prepared to leave strong clues in his novel entitled The Tunnel Thru The Air, which he wrote in 1927. This book describes the events in the United States leading up to the Second World War through the life of the principal character, Robert Gordon. Most importantly, in the foreword to this book Gann wrote, The Tunnel Thru The Air is mysterious and contains a valuable secret, clothed in veiled language..When you read it the third time, a new light will dawn. You will find the hidden secret..The future will become an open book. Ganns valuable secret, clothed in veiled language is that, as the Bible clearly states, astrology really works. This theme runs throughout the book and is highlighted in the following quotations: Robert was a great believer in Astrology because he had found this great science referred to so many times in the Holy Bible. He had made notes as he read the Bible at different times where it referred to Astrology or the signs in the heavens and was thoroughly convinced that the influence of the heavenly bodies govern our lives (page 172). I believe in the stars, I believe in astrology, and I have figured out my destiny. The Bible makes it plain that the stars do rule (page 66). Through my study of the Bible, I have determined the major and minor time factors which repeat in the history of nations, men and markets (page 70). I have studied the Bible very carefully because I believe it is the greatest scientific book ever written. The laws are plainly laid down how to make a success. There is a time and a season for everything and if a man does things according to the time, he will succeed (page 204). Robert had gone deeply into the Bible study in order to learn more about the great science of Astrology (page 213). He read all the books he could get on astrology and began to understand why thing had happened as they had (page 215).

Shrinking time For a possible explanation let us consider the following experience that I had as a child growing up in Northern Canada, where the seasonal changes are dramatic. As a boy of four years I recall being amazed when winter came and snow appeared again (as it had done one year previously since time immemorial). It seemed to me that I could remember this white stuff falling out of the sky and piling up all over the place. It had happened, I thought, a long time ago and here it was happening again. As I grew I found that it did indeed occur on a regular basis, a yearly basis, but like every one I noticed that as I grew older the time interval seemed to mysteriously grow shorter even though there were still 365.25 days in the year, none added or subtracted. It occurred to me that the only explanation for this shrinking time was my own previous experience of time. To a child of four years, one year would represent 25% of my total previous experience of time to that date. But now that I am 40 years old, one year represents only 2.5% of my previous total experience of time. This is a dramatic decrease by a factor of 10. By the time I am 80, one year will only represent 1.25% of my previous experience. Thus the longer a person lives the smaller a year becomes in relation to their total previous experience of time in this life. (SB 4.29.2b) Calculation of time (SB 3.11.1-12) The atomic description of the Srimad Bhagavatam is almost the same as that of modern science. This is further described in the Paramanu-vada of Kanada. Time is measured in terms of its covering a certain space of atoms. Standard time is calculated in terms of the movement of the sun. The time covered by the sun in passing over an atom is calculated as atomic time. Two atoms Three double atoms Three hexatoms One hundred trutis Three vedas Three lavas Three nimesas Five ksanas Fifteen kasthas Fifteen laghus Two dandas Six to seven dandas Fifteen days and nights Two fortnights - a double atom - a hexatom (a particle visible in sunshine) - a truti or 18 atomic particles, or one second divided in 16,875 parts. - one veda - one lava - one nimesa - one ksana - one kastha or 8 seconds - one laghu or 2 minutes - one (nadika-danda) or 30 minutes - one muhurta or one hour - one prahara or quarter of a day - two weeks or a fortnight - one month During the period of one month the moon wanes and is called krsna-paksa, the dark moon or amavasya. In the same month the moon waxes and is called gaura-paksa or sukla-paksa, the full moon or purnima. Thus purnima to amavasya is called krsna-paksa (dark moon) and amavasya to purnima is called sukla-paksa (bright moon). Two months equal one season. During the first six months the sun travels from south to north (uttarayana). During the second six months the sun travels from north to south (daksinayana). Two solar movements equal one day and night of the demigods.

Four cosmic ages (yugas) Krta or Satya-yuga (Golden Age) Duration - 4,800 demigods years or 1,728,000 human years Life span - 100,000 years Yuga-dharma - meditation or astanga yoga Yuga-avatara - white with four arms, has matted hair and wears a garment of tree bark. He carries a black deerskin, a sacred thread, prayer beads and the rod and waterpot of a brahmacari. (SB 11.5.21) Symptoms of Satya-yuga The people are peaceful, non-envious, friendly and naturally Krsna conscious. In Satya-yuga there was no division of asrama, everyone was a paramahamsa. There was no demigod worship, only the worship of Krsna and religion was perfectly practiced. (SB 9.14, 11.5.21-22) Treta-yuga (Silver Age) Duration - 3,600 demigod years or 1,296,000 human years Life span - 10,000 years Yuga-dharma - Fire sacrifice (yajna) Yuga-avatara - red with four arms and golden hair. He wears a triple belt representing initiation into the three Vedas. His symbols are the sruk, sruva, etc. (ladle, spoon and other implements of sacrifice). Symptoms of Treta-yuga In Treta-yuga the people are thoroughly religious. In Satya-yuga people are naturally Krsna conscious. In Treta-yuga they are inclined to become Krsna conscious. To achieve that end they are very strict in following Vedic principles. Dvapara-yuga (Copper Age) Duration - 2,400 demigod years or 864,000 human years Life span - 1,000 years Yuga-dharma - Temple worship (arcana) Yuga-avatara - his complexion is dark blue. He wears yellow garments. His body is marked with Srivatsa and other distinctive ornaments, and He manifests His personal weapons. The original Personality of Godhead from whom all other incarnations expand is Sri Krsna. He appears once in a day of Brahma, during the period of the seventh Manu (Vaivasvata) in the 28th divya-yuga. The original Personality of Godhead Krsna only comes once in a day of Brahma. Although in every Dvapara-yuga there is a yuga-avatara, they are all expansions of Visnu, who is an expansion of Sri Krsna. Symptoms of Dvapara-yuga In Dvapara-yuga people have the weaknesses of mortal beings, but they have a strong desire to know about the Absolute Truth and they worship the Lord in the mood of honoring a great king, following the prescriptions of both Vedas and tantras. Kali-yuga (Iron Age) Duration - 1,200 demigod years or 432,000 human years Life span - 100 years Yuga-dharma - Chanting the Hare Krsna mahamantra (harinama sankirtana) Yuga-avatara - golden or yellow but generally black. Lord Caitanya, who is Krsna Himself, appears only in the Kali-yuga immediately following the appearance of Sri Krsna in Dvaparayuga.

15

Symptoms of Kali-yuga "O learned one in the age of Kali, men have but short lives. They are quarrelsome, lazy, misguided unlucky and above all, always disturbed." (SB 1.1.10) The four yugas are known as a divya-yuga, or maha-yuga. One divya-yuga is 12,000 years of the demigods (4,320,000 human years). One thousand divya-yugas equals one day of Brahma (4,320,000,000 human years). In Brahma's one day there are fourteen Manus (patriarchs of mankind). Each Manu enjoys a life of seventy-one divya-yugas or 852,000 years of the demigods (306,720,000 human years). After the dissolution of every Manu a new Manu comes. With the change of Manu the universal management also changes. Each manvantara is preceded and followed by the yuga-sandhya in length of one Satya-yuga. The yuga-sandhyas are periods of partial devastation and creation. Brahma's life consists of 36,000 days and nights (of the same length), or 311,040,000,000,000 human years. We live in Kali-yuga of the 28th divya-yuga of the 7th Manu of the 12th kalpa (called SvetaVaraha) (SB 2.10.46p., Skanda P. 2.39-42), in the 51th year of Brahma. The beginning of this kalpa was 2.3 billion years ago (453 mahayugas back).
